Sean's Story

When Sean O'Connor was dumped at a New Jersey shelter, she was marked for death.  Being a little temperamental, and not liking other animals, she was a "hard to place" cat and all to routinely killed.

Before Sean's execution date there were some kitties in need at a local vet's office, and Sean became a blood donor and saved quite a few little lives.  One would think that saving so many lives, her own life would be spared, unfortunately that was not the case, she still had her date with death.

JCS got wind of Sean's plight and we were off and running.  No way this little kitty who had rescued so many herself, was going to die, not if we knew about it.

We pulled Sean out, had a bit of a time with her.  She was temperamental, yet kind and loving.  She hated other cats and animals; so we had to build Sean her own apartment.  Cages are not an option here at JCS.  We are not a kitty prison.  We built Sean her own 8x8 house.  It is Sean's "Catty" shack; decorated in pinks and purples; wall to wall carpet for her and a nice Kitty Loft, so she can climb up high.  Sean even has a pink litter box.  Sean now spends her days playing with purple toy mice, eating the best foods, enjoying love and cuddles from JCS and never again will have to worry about being murdered.
